臭氧对温室土壤化学性质和甜瓜产量的影响

摘    要:研究了臭氧处理对温室土壤化学性质和甜瓜单瓜质量的影响.结果表明,随着臭氧处理剂量的升高,土壤有机质下降,其中高剂量臭氧处理后10~15 cm土层有机质含量显著低于对照;各土层氨态氮显著下降,土壤pH值、EC值、硝态氮上升,全氮、全磷、有效磷呈下降趋势,但处理与对照间均未达到显著水平;臭氧处理对土壤全钾、速效钾无明显影响,但可促进大棚甜瓜单果质量增加,其中低剂量处理单瓜质量显著高于对照.

The effects of ozone treatment on greenhouse soil chemical properties and melon yield

Abstract:The effects of ozone treatment on soil chemical properties and single-fruit weight were studied.The results showed that the content of soil organic matter decreased along with the increase of ozone concentration.The content of soil organic matter in 10~15 cm deep was lower than the control after treated with higher concentration of ozone.NH+4-N reduced remarkably in every layer,soil pH,EC,NO3-N rose,the total N,total P and available P decreased,but not significantly difference were found with the control.No obvious effects were also observed on total K and active K under different treatment of ozone.The single-fruit weight increased and reached remarkably level under the low ozone concentration treatment.
